Dumpster Tips to Save Space and Cut Costs

At Jr's Mini Roll Off, we understand that making the most of your dumpster needs more than putting trash in randomly. Properly organizing and loading materials can significantly increase the capacity, enabling you to manage more debris at once. Begin with flat, heavy objects such as furniture or drywall along the container walls to establish stability. Lightweight items such as cardboard, insulation, and packaging should be layered on top, while bulky items should be broken down whenever possible. This approach maintains balance and avoids shifting while moving while making full use of the dumpster space.

Dealing with Bulky and Irregular Waste

Bulky or debris removal service irregularly shaped items often pose challenges when filling a dumpster. We encourage clients to break down large pieces whenever possible, whether it is furniture, wooden pallets, or construction materials. Cutting, folding, or disassembling items allows them to fit more efficiently within the container, freeing up additional space for other waste. Preventing Frequent Dumpster Errors

Homeowners and contractors often make errors that limit rental effectiveness. Overfilling one side, placing heavy items on top of fragile ones, or neglecting to distribute weight evenly can limit the amount of waste you can manage.
